OpenIntake
YC W25New York City, US · Founded 2025 · 2 employees · 1 known investors
OpenIntake provides AI-powered intake automation for law firms that captures and converts phone inquiries into client matters around the clock.

Founders & leadership· Y Combinator alumni (W25)
OpenIntake was founded in 2025 by Yash Sahota and Grayson Pike.
YS
Yash SahotainFounderYash Sahota is a computer science graduate from Cornell (2020) who previously worked as a product security engineer at Slack and as a consultant at McKinsey & Company. He is co-founder of OpenIntake.
GP
Grayson PikeinFounderGrayson Pike is a co-founder of OpenIntake and previously worked as a consultant at McKinsey & Company and as a back-end tech lead at a hedge fund. He graduated from the University of Texas at Austin in 2021.
